PrintVegan Vegetable Soup
- Total Time: 45 minutes
- Yield: 10 Servings 1x
- Diet: Vegan

Ingredients

- 6 1/2 cups water & vegetable bouillon
- 1 cup red onion, diced
- 3 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 bay leaf
- 1 tablespoon fresh basil, diced
- 2 celery stalks, diced (1/4 inch (or smaller) pieces)
- 1 1/2 cup tomatoes, diced
- 2 large potatoes, chopped into 1 inch sized cubes
- 1/2 head green cabbage, chopped
- 1 1/2 cup great northern beans, cooked
- 1 teaspoon ground black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on Himalayan salt
Instructions
- In a large pot, half of a cup of water, onion, garlic and cook until onions are semi-translucent.
- Add remaining water and vegetable bouillon and bring to a boil.
- Add all remaining ingredients and simmer for 20 minutes.
- Enjoy!
Notes
Feel free to use canned Great Northern Beans and/or tomatoes if you want to save a bit of time. Buy organic with NO added salt if possible.
